#0b2013 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0b2013 is composed of 4.3% red, 12.5% green and 7.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 40.6% yellow and 87.5% black. It has a hue angle of 142.9 degrees, a saturation of 48.8% and a lightness of 8.4%. #0b2013 color hex could be obtained by blending #164026 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

Shades and Tints of #0b2013

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010302 is the darkest color, while #f3fbf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#0b2013

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#151615 is the less saturated color, while #012a11 is the most saturated one.
